TICKET-4182: Query planner regression on Fennelworth staging. New joiners: the staging box was provisioned with the legacy planner flags, so index hints are ignored and the orders table does full scans. Fix is to repoint the planner service at the tuned config bundle. Add the following line to the staging env file before restarting the planner.

vault entry, yajop-bafop: ARCHIVE_KEY3=8d4

Ticket: drift in dependency pinning for the Mosswick build pipeline. Several services have unpinned transitive dependencies despite the policy adopted last quarter, and two lockfiles were regenerated without review. Future maintainers should treat the pinning manifest as the single source of truth and reject builds that bypass it. To restore a consistent baseline, apply the configuration values listed directly below.

settings of fafog-haduf:
ZORIX_PIN=4648
ZORIX_METRICS_HOST=metrics.zorix.paliqsys.corp
ZORIX_LOG_LEVEL=info
ZORIX_TENANT=druix

Runbook 7.3 — Account recovery and per-tenant quotas (Harkwell)

When recovering a suspended account, verify the tenant's rate quota first: recovery flows consume from the same bucket as normal API traffic, and a depleted quota will silently fail the reset. Temporarily raise the tenant to the burst tier, complete recovery, then revert within one hour and log the change for review. To authorize the quota override, enter the recovery passphrase below.

vault phrase of taweg-kafof = oliax-zorael

Handing off the Quillbus broker upgrade (4.x to 5.1) to Dario. Cluster is half-migrated; mixed-version mode is supported but TLS cert rotation must finish before cutover. No auth model changes, though the admin API gained two new endpoints worth reviewing. Open questions and the migration checklist are tracked on the internal page below.

dashboard of taduf-bawef = https://jira.lumicsys.internal/projects/display/browse/b1cbf89d

Runbook: Snackline restock planner account recovery. If the planner service account gets locked (usually after the Friday route-import job hammers the login), don't just retry — that extends the lockout. Instead, flag it at eng sync, disable the import cron, and run the recovery flow from the Snackline ops console. Routes re-queue automatically once the account is back. The recovery flow will prompt for the passphrase given below.

strongbox words: norwyn-wenael-aldvan-aldiel-wendor-holael